+ defer file.Close()
+
+ bar := progressbar.DefaultBytes(res.ContentLength, "Downloading france-latest.osm.pbf")
+ if resuming {
+ // Re-append to the partial file when the server honored the range request.
+ if _, err := file.Seek(offset, io.SeekStart); err != nil {
+ return err
+ }
+ }
+ _, err = io.Copy(io.MultiWriter(file, bar), res.Body)
+ if err != nil {
+ return fmt.Errorf("failed to download %s: %w", francePBFRUL, err)
+ }
+ if size, err := file.Stat(); err == nil && size.Size() != total {
+ return fmt.Errorf("download incomplete: got %d bytes, want %d", size.Size(), total)
+ }
+ return nil
+}
